Location That Actually Matters
You know what’s rare in Istanbul? Finding a hotel where you can genuinely walk to everything without feeling like you need a sherpa guide. The Golden Horn Bosphorus Hotel nailed this — I’m talking about a 5-minute stroll to the Spice Bazaar and maybe 10 minutes to Galata Bridge if you’re taking your time. The Eminönü ferry terminal is right there too, which honestly saves you so much hassle when you want to hop across to the Asian side or cruise up the Bosphorus. Plus, they’ve got free private parking on-site, which is basically like finding unicorns in this part of the city.

What Sets It Apart
The staff here genuinely knows the neighborhood, and I don’t mean they just hand you a tourist map and wish you luck. They’ll tell you which ferry to take for the best sunset views, or where to grab the best börek without the tourist markup. The hotel’s restaurant serves solid Turkish breakfast — nothing fancy, but fresh bread, good cheese, and strong tea that actually wakes you up. What really impressed me was how they handle the little things, like helping arrange taxi pickups or giving you realistic walking times to attractions.

The room is big and comfortable. Everything is brand new and clean. Very fast internet connection and easy to log in.
Hotal is located about 8 - 10 minutes walk to Egiptian Bazaar, 20 - 25 minutes walk to Grand Bazaar and 1 minute to the train station.
Upon arrival I was welcomed with a complementary drink and some Turkish delight sweets.
I was given better room than booked (with a vew to the sea).
I was offered late check-out (2 hours extra) free of charge.
After collecting the luggage store room (a few hours after the checkout) I was offered free tea from the hotel.
My taxi could not arrive to the hotel (Friday traffic), so a person from the hotel took my luggage, carried that himself and walked with me a couple of minutes to find a taxi. What a great service!
